Tony Hardy’s Aurora Superman
This is the Monogram re-pop of the old 1960s Aurora kit. The head is an aftermarket replacement piece that looks just like actor George Reeves who played Superman on TV in the 1950s.
Needless to say, this kit has a lot of part fit problems. It required a great deal of puttying & sanding. So much so, that I thought I’d never get the thing completed.
I spent a great deal of time attempting to get the bricks & mortar painted realistically, plus getting the suit to look like the cloth suit that George Reeves wore. All in all I think it turned out pretty well.
The Aurora Superman kit was the first model I built as a child. It was fun to return to it 44 years later and finally do it justice.
